I did it ! Full led on, full led off. Enjoy !
Code:; SCROLLING THERMOMETER ; FINAL VERSION ; By NICULESCU DAN ; SEPTEMBER, 13, 2011 ; ; .oooO ; ( ) Oooo. ; \ ( ( ) ; \_) ) / ; (_/ ; @ DEVICE pic16F628A, intOSC_osc_noclkout, WDT_OFF, PWRT_OFF, BOD_OFF, MCLR_off define osc 4 INTCON = 0 TRISA = %00000000 ' CATODES TO PORTA TRISB = %10000000 ' ANODES TO PORTB CMCON = 7 DQ var PortB.7 '*************************************************************************************** eeprom 0, [%10100001,%01111010,%01110110,%01101110,%10100001] '0 eeprom 5, [%11111111,%01111101,%00000000,%01111111,%11111111] '1 eeprom 10,[%01111101,%00111110,%01101110,%01110110,%01111001] '2 eeprom 15,[%10111101,%01111110,%01110110,%01110110,%10101001] '3 eeprom 20,[%11100111,%11101011,%11101101,%00000000,%11101111] '4 eeprom 25,[%10111000,%01111010,%01111010,%01111010,%10100110] '5 eeprom 30,[%10100001,%01110110,%01110110,%01110110,%10101101] '6 eeprom 35,[%11111110,%00001110,%11110110,%11111010,%11111100] '7 eeprom 40,[%10001001,%01110110,%01110110,%01110110,%10001001] '8 eeprom 45,[%11111001,%01110110,%01110110,%01110110,%10001001] '9 counter var byte scan var byte scroll var byte leddata var byte[36] 'Column Data for display 36 columns temperature var Word 'reading from sensor Sign var BIT tempA var byte 'Stores First digit (High) tempB var byte 'stores Second digit (Mid) tempC var byte 'stores Third digit (low) n var byte DS18B20_12bit CON %01111111 START: CLEAR ' Init Sensor OWOUT DQ, 1, [$CC, $4E, 0, 0, DS18B20_12bit] OWOut DQ, 1, [$CC, $48] OWOut DQ, 1, [$CC, $B8] OWOut DQ, 1, [$CC, $BE] Pause 50 OWIn DQ, 2, [temperature.byte0, temperature.byte1] Pause 50 OWOut DQ, 1, [$CC, $44] OWOut DQ, 1, [$CC, $BE] OWIn DQ, 2, [temperature.byte0, temperature.byte1] Sign = temperature.15 temperature= ABS(temperature) temperature=((temperature >> 4)*100) + ((temperature & $F) * 100 >> 4) if sign then temperature= -temperature ; temperature=2340 ; UNCOMMENT FOR DISPLAY TEST tempA = temperature DIG 3 tempB = temperature DIG 2 tempC = temperature DIG 1 if tempA = 0 then FOR counter = 0 TO 4 leddata [counter+8] = %11111111 next else for counter = 0 to 4 READ tempA*5+counter,leddata [counter+8] 'stores 1st digit in leddata locations 8,9,10,11,12 NEXT endif FOR counter = 0 TO 4 READ tempB*5+counter,leddata [counter+14] 'stores 2nd digit in leddata locations 14,15,16,17,18 NEXT FOR counter = 0 TO 4 READ tempC*5+counter,leddata [counter+23] 'stores 3rd digit in leddata locations 23,24,25,26,27 NEXT for n=0 to 7 leddata [n] = %11111111 next n leddata [13] = %11111111 leddata [19] = %11111111 leddata [20] = %00111111 ' DECIMAL POINT leddata [21] = %00111111 leddata [22] = %11111111 leddata [28] = %11111111 leddata [29] = %11111100 ' degrees c leddata [30] = %11111100 leddata [31] = %11100011 leddata [32] = %10111101 leddata [33] = %10111101 leddata [34] = %10111101 leddata [35] = %11111111 LOOPing: FOR scroll = 0 TO 35 FOR scan = 0 TO 10 PORTA=%11111111 PAUSE 1 PORTb = 1 FOR counter = 0 TO 7 PORTa = leddata [counter] pAUSE 1 PORTb = PORTb * 2 NEXT NEXT FOR counter = 0 TO 34 leddata [counter] = leddata [counter+1] NEXT NEXT GOTO START END
